FRIDAY 12.26.2014 Box Office Report

Posted December 27, 2014 by Mitch Metcalf

Based on Friday’s grosses, weekend #52 of 2014 looks like $192 million for the top 12 films Friday-Sunday, up +21% from the norm for this weekend ($158 million) and up +6% from the same weekend last year.   Opening at 3,131 theaters Thursday, Unbroken from Universal is on track for a $32.3 million opening three-day weekend (well above […]

Year to Date Box Office & Worldwide Studio Scorecard 5.26.2019

Posted May 26, 2019 by Mitch Metcalf

WORLDWIDE STUDIO SCORECARD.  Here is an updated look at the 2019 film slates by studio. BOX OFFICE. Looking at North American box office, 2019 is still -10% below last year’s comparable span and now -1% below the average at this point the past four years ($3.913 billion).  Over the same period, Hollywood films have grossed almost […]
